Conor McGregor still doesn’t appear to think much of Dustin Poirier”s victory in their most recent match.
He posted a video showing the ugly broken leg he suffered during the fight.
The mixed martial arts legend boasted that he still got a number of shots off even after breaking his left tibia and fibula at UFC 264 in July. McGregor lost in a first-round knockout.
“Good angle. Can see the leg was broke before I even stood up,” McGregor tweeted. “It was broke before the guillotine even. It’s why I went for it. Four shots to zero here in this clip to close the fight before the injury. This fight was going my way 100%.”

McGregor’s manager Audie Attar said to SunSport that McGregor is making good progress and is on his feet hitting pads.
Attar added McGregor’s injuries are “healing beautifully,” noting McGregor wants to leave the Octagon on his own terms.
